You will not go to a random village in Hue, the destination will be the famous Thuy Chanh village, which stands the Thanh Toan Bridge – the oldest bridge in Hue. The local market will be your first stop. There we will buy necessary ingredients for our Hue Countryside cooking tour. Then, we will move to a local farm house of Ms. Nua and explore their organic vegetable garden. While enjoying their Vietnamese tea which you can not find anywhere else, you get to talk to them and learn how they practice farming with traditional method for generations. Later, we will prepare the ingredients and learn to cook.
It is time for you to do hands-on cooking class 3 Hue traditional dishes with the instruction from Ms. Nua.The lesson will finish at lunchtime, as you can enjoy your dishes along with 2 special Hue dishes from the host. However, that is not the end, you still have a Vietnamese coffee making lesson to learn. Now you officially become a real Hue masterchef.
Once finish having lunch, you will be saying goodbye to our wonderful hosts and head back to town. You will be provided list of ingredients and cooking techniques to practice at home.
